Responsibilities

What will I be doing?

The Front Office Manager is responsible for driving company success through performing the following tasks to the highest standards:

  • Manage the delivery of efficient check-in and check-out services and coordination of front office activities with other departments to ensure all standards are met and excellent customer service is provided.
  • Ensure all guests/owners are being treated in an efficient and courteous manner
  • Responsible for assisting with training and direct new department employees
  • Ensure all Front Office quality standards are followed and that all policies and procedures are consistently applied
  • Work in conjunction with accounting to maintain and minimize levels of account receivables
  • Coordinate activities with other hotel departments in order to facilitate increased levels of communication and guest satisfaction
  • Assist in the daily maintenance of room inventory status to achieve optimal levels of revenues while maintaining high levels of guests' expectations
  • Ensure the timely completion of performance appraisals
  • Act as a liaison between the resort and timeshare guests/owners to ensure spectacular level of customer service
  • Facilitate the resolution of any concerns/complaints for the guest and/ or refer and follow-up with appropriate personnel


Qualifications

What are we looking for?

To fulfill this role successfully, you must possess the following minimum qualifications and experience:

  • 1-5 years of related experience
  • 1+ years management or supervisory experience
  • Front Office operations experience in hospitality environment.
  • Prior cash handling and computer experience required.
  • Ability to lead each field of the department independently.
  • Demonstrates excellence in service quality standards that affect guest satisfaction, responding to guests in a timely and professional manner. A courteous and professional demeanor must prevail when handling upset guests and difficult situations.
